What companies run services between Peckham, England and Blackheath, Greater London, England?

Southeastern operates a train from Peckham Rye to Blackheath every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£1–4 and the journey takes 12 min. Alternatively, Stagecoach London operates a bus from Old Kent Road / Ilderton Road to Greenwich Park every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 18 min. Go Ahead London also services this route hourly.
